This is a senior management level position responsible for accomplishing results through the management of a team or department in an effort to establish and implement new or revised application systems and programs in coordination with the Technology Team. The overall objective of this role is to drive applications systems analysis and programming activities.

QUALIFICATIONS:

  • 10+ years of professional experience building Java-based (Java 8+) web applications
  • Strong proficiency in core Java including OOP principles, Collections, Multi-threading & Concurrency, Streams, Lambda.
  • Solid understanding with containerization and microservices architecture(Docker, Kubernetes, OpenShift)
  • Excellent knowledge and Work experience in Spring Framework such as Spring Boot, Spring Data, etc.
  • Strong knowledge and work experience in ORM framework like JPA/Hibernate.
  • Solid understanding of Messaging Middleware (Kafka, etc.)
  • Familiarity of distributed cache (Redis, etc.)
  • Knowledge of DevOps tools such as Jenkins, Git/Bitbucket, Harness, etc. for automation and efficient management of the software development lifecycle
  • Understanding of the domain driven design (DDD) software design approach
  • Experience in writing unit testing using Junit and Mockito
  • Demonstrable experience in writing clean, reusable, testable code.
  • Demonstrable understanding and experience of engineering best practices: design patterns, coding standard, code review, unit testing.
  • Experience with relational database like Oracle

EDUCATION: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science or related field
  • Master’s degree preferred

Responsibilities
  • Design, develop, and maintain Java web applications using Spring Boot within a microservices architecture
  • Engage in the full software development lifecycle (SDLC), including planning, development, testing, and deployment, with a focus on cloud-based environments like OpenShift, ensuring adherence to best practices in CI/CD pipelines with an SDLC framework
  • Work collaboratively with cross-functional teams in a distributed, global environment to deliver projects aligned with strategic business objectives
  • Man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ced setting, rapidly adapting to changes in business requirements and technology landscapes
